What Are Lip Fillers?
Lip injections are a minor and temporary cosmetic procedure to fill the lips to look gorgeous and natural. There are different types of lip fillers. The most common one is hyaluronic acid injections. Hyaluronic acid is naturally produced in the body that promotes healthy skin and adds or restores volume.

What Is The Procedure?
The procedure is almost painless, and it lasts about 30 minutes. Make sure to tell the doctor if you are taking any medication, if you have any illnesses, allergies, or have a similar procedure in the area.
After the procedure, it is vital to keep the body hydrated. Please don’t forget to ask the specialist about the amount of water you must drink daily and maintain the same quantity for at least seven days. Avoid going to the beach, sauna, intensive training, and anything that can dehydrate the body after the lip injections.
The most common side effects are:
- Redness
- Swelling
- Bruising
Please note that sometimes small irregularities can appear, so the doctor might tell you to give your lips a gentle massage during the first couple of days.
If you are not satisfied with the results, don’t worry. One of the primary advantages of hyaluronic injections is that the fillers are 100% absorbed by the body after six to nine months.
If you can’t wait that long your doctor can also use an eraser enzyme to instantly dissolve the filler returning the lips to their natural volume and shape.
